How Pricing Works and What a Quote Covers

The rate is set on the phone before anything is scheduled. There is no estimate that turns into something different after delivery. When you call, we go through the unit types, the number of units, how long the rental runs, and how often servicing is needed. Those four things shape the quote, and the quote covers all of them.

Servicing frequency is the piece most people do not think about until it is a problem. For typical use, routine visits run about twice a week. Busier sites, higher-traffic events, and larger crew counts push that number up. We talk through what the site actually looks like and set a schedule that fits it. A single-weekend event and a four-month construction rental are priced differently because they are different jobs.

Ask what the quote covers and you get a straight answer. The price is confirmed before delivery is booked, and that is when you decide.

What Placement on Ground You Do Not Own Requires

Not every rental goes on private property. Community events in Oak Park sometimes use shared grounds, park spaces, or rights-of-way, and placement on that kind of ground usually needs sign-off from whoever manages it.

Whether a permit is required depends on the specific location and who controls it. Rules differ between city-managed property and county-managed property, and between a private venue and a public right-of-way. We confirm what applies at your address before delivery is scheduled. If the placement needs paperwork, we talk through what that looks like and what you will need to arrange on your end.

The straightforward version: call us with the address, tell us where you are thinking of placing the units, and we sort out whether anything needs to be confirmed before the truck shows up.

Put It Where People Are Not Going to Notice It

Placement matters more than most people expect before the units arrive. A portable restroom positioned in the background of an outdoor ceremony is a problem. One placed too close to a food table is a different kind of problem. Both are avoidable with a few minutes of conversation before delivery.

When you call, tell us what the space looks like and what is happening in it. A crew working a renovation needs units close enough to be practical without being in the way of material deliveries. A private event on a residential lot needs units placed where guests can find them without walking past them every time they look up. We have placed units in enough different situations to know which questions to ask.

Screening and orientation are worth thinking about too. We can discuss which direction the door should face and whether the placement keeps the unit out of direct sightlines. The goal is for the unit to be easy to find and easy to ignore at the same time.

When the Job Does Not Fit a Standard Rental

Warehouse and Distribution Sites Under Construction

Large interior builds and distribution center construction often run long timelines with rotating crews. Sanitation needs to be close to where the work is happening, not at the perimeter of the site. We set up service schedules that match shift patterns and scale the unit count as the crew size changes over the course of the project.

Campgrounds and Overflow Parking Areas

Temporary overflow areas and seasonal campground expansions need units that can handle extended use without becoming a maintenance problem. Regular servicing keeps them functional, and holding tanks are available for locations without a nearby sewer connection.

Sporting Events, Tournaments and Race Days

High-traffic events with defined start and end times need a unit count that handles peak demand, not average demand. ADA-accessible units are part of any public event setup. We size the order around the attendance estimate and the event length, and we talk through whether the schedule calls for servicing during the event or only before and after.

Livestock Events, Rodeos and Equestrian Shows

These events have specific placement challenges. Units need to be accessible to attendees without being in the path of animals or equipment. Servicing schedules for multi-day shows are set before the event starts, not adjusted on the fly.

Golf Courses, Marinas and Recreation Grounds

Spread-out sites need units positioned at intervals rather than grouped in one location. A golf course needs sanitation at points along the course. A marina needs coverage near the water without units sitting in areas that flood or restrict access. We plan placement around the site layout before delivery.

Demolition and Site-Clearance Work

Demolition sites move fast and the footprint of the work changes as the project progresses. Units need to be repositioned as the site changes, and servicing needs to keep pace with a crew that may be working in dusty, high-volume conditions. We handle repositioning as part of the rental when the job calls for it.

Events That Need Full Accessibility

ADA-accessible units are not optional at public events. They are part of the order from the start. For larger gatherings, we follow the guideline of roughly one ADA unit for every 20 units in the total order. For smaller events, at least one accessible unit is included regardless of total count. Porta Potty Rental Units and Straight Answers to Common Questions

Every job and every event has a right unit for it, and the lineup below covers the full range we carry for Oak Park and the surrounding Cook County area. Use this table to match your situation to the right equipment, then call us and we will confirm the count, confirm the size, and get delivery on the calendar.

UnitBest Suited ForNotable FeaturesGood to Know
Standard Restroom with Hand SinkFarmers markets, school events, church functions, film shoots
  • Interior hand-wash sink
  • Same footprint as standard unit
  • Toilet paper included
  • Good where space limits a separate station
A practical choice when you want handwashing built into the restroom rather than handled by a separate stand-alone station nearby.
Deluxe Flushable RestroomOutdoor weddings, graduation parties, upscale gatherings
  • Foot-pump flush
  • Fresh-water sink and mirror
  • More finished interior
  • Event-grade presentation
When a standard unit would feel out of place, this is the step up. Works well alongside restroom trailers on larger events that need a mix of unit types.
ADA / Wheelchair-Accessible RestroomAny permitted or public event, mixed-ability job sites
  • Ground-level entry, no step
  • Roomy interior for wheelchair clearance
  • Grab bars and accessible-height fixtures
  • Required at most permitted events
Plan for at least one ADA unit on every event order, and roughly one ADA unit for every 20 units on larger orders. We carry them for any order size.
Rolling / Elevator-Fit UnitMulti-floor and high-rise construction sites
  • Caster wheels for floor-to-floor movement
  • Narrow profile sized for freight elevators
  • Keeps sanitation near the active work level
  • Built for commercial construction use
Designed specifically for high-rise and multi-story builds across the Chicago metro where workers need access without a trip to ground level.
Crane-Hoistable UnitElevated work decks, rooftop construction, high-rise builds
  • Reinforced lifting frame
  • Rated for crane or sling transport
  • Positions sanitation at height
  • Commercial construction grade
The right call when the work deck is elevated and there is no elevator access. Keeps the crew from losing time making trips down to a lower level.
Trailer-Mounted Single UnitRemote sites, frequently relocated jobs, rural properties
  • Restroom mounted on a tow trailer
  • Easy to reposition between locations
  • Self-contained and fully stocked on arrival
  • Good for sites without fixed placement
A practical solution when the job moves or when a site is too remote or irregular for a standard drop placement.
Restroom Trailer, 2-StationSmall weddings, private parties, intimate gatherings
  • Private flushing stalls
  • Running water at the sink
  • Interior lighting
  • Climate option available
A compact trailer that fits where a large multi-stall unit would be too much. Works well for events of 75 to 150 guests depending on event length.
Restroom Trailer, Multi-StationFestivals, large weddings, corporate outdoor events, 5K races
  • Multiple private stalls for men and women
  • Running water and interior lighting
  • Climate control option
  • Handles high guest volume
High-traffic events benefit from the throughput a multi-stall trailer provides. Call us with your attendance estimate and we will recommend the right stall count.
Luxury / VIP Wedding Restroom TrailerUpscale weddings, VIP sections, corporate galas, film productions
  • High-end interior finishes and vanities
  • Climate control and interior lighting
  • Running water throughout
  • Presentation matches the occasion
When the event's presentation matters as much as the logistics, these trailers deliver a guest experience that standard units cannot. Available for full event setups or VIP areas only.
ADA Restroom TrailerLarge events requiring accessible trailer facilities
  • Lowering chassis or ramp for wheelchair access
  • Accessible stall plus standard stalls
  • Running water and interior lighting
  • Pairs well with standard trailers
The right choice when a large event needs ADA compliance in a trailer format. Pairs alongside standard restroom trailers to cover the full range of guest needs.
Shower Trailer / Shower-Restroom ComboDisaster relief, remote construction crews, multi-day festivals
  • Private shower stalls with hot water
  • Changing area included
  • Combination units add restroom stalls
  • Self-contained water system
Deployed for disaster relief operations, crew camps, and any multi-day event or remote job where workers need to clean up on site.
Hand-Wash StationFood-service events, school carnivals, high-traffic outdoor events
  • Foot-pump fresh water supply
  • Soap and paper towel dispenser
  • Self-contained, no plumbing needed
  • Pairs with any porta potty order
A strong addition to any order where food is served or where hygiene is a priority. Arrives stocked and ready to use alongside the restroom units.
Hand-Sanitizer StationEvent entrances, high-traffic walkways, indoor-outdoor transitions
  • Touch-free dispensing
  • ADA-compliant height
  • No water or plumbing needed
  • Easy to reposition on site
Useful at entry points and anywhere guests move between areas. Works as a supplement to hand-wash stations rather than a replacement when soap and water are available.
Holding TankRemote properties, farms, pipeline sites, off-grid locations
  • Stores waste where no sewer connection exists
  • Fresh-water and waste-water capacity
  • Keeps site compliant until service arrives
  • Sized for extended use between service visits
We pump and service the holding tanks we place. This is not septic-tank service. It covers the portable sanitation equipment we deliver and maintain.
Spill-Containment TrayIndoor placements, sensitive flooring, warehouse and facility events
  • Catches drips and minor spills
  • Protects flooring and ground surfaces
  • Fits under standard portable restroom footprint
  • Low-profile and easy to position
A practical add-on when a unit is placed on a surface that cannot tolerate any moisture. Often required for indoor placements or events on finished floors.
